A 51-year-old man has been busted for harboring 12 girls, some of whom he abused, at his Pennsylvania home, authorities said.

Lee Kaplan of Feasterville, which is about 20 miles outside Philadelphia, was arrested Thursday and faces a number of charges including statutory sexual assault and aggravated indecent assault related to the girls — who range in age from 6 months to 18 years.

A Pennsylvania couple allegedly gave away one of the girls, their 14-year-old daughter, to Kaplan for money. The couple is accused of child endangerment.

That girl’s father, Daniel Stoltzfus, said he did online research and was under the impression that it was legal to give his daughter to Kaplan after the man helped his family financially, court papers state.

Stoltzfus is charged with conspiracy of statutory sexual assault and children endangerment. His wife, Savilla Stoltzfus, has also been charged with endangering the welfare of a child. The couple told police the other nine girls in the house were their children.

Kaplan and the couple all are being held on $1 million bail.

The girl, now 18, told police she and Kaplan have a 3-year-old child and a 6-month-old.
